Omacro is a Global Seller Locator / Dealer Locator / Where-to-Buy platform for brands, suppliers, and their channel partners. Its core goal is to help website visitors quickly find trusted online sellers, offline dealers, distributors, installers, service centers, or rental providers from a product or brand page, then take the next step via links, phone calls, or map navigation.
Based on the available site content, Omacro emphasizes a “simple deployment” buying and location experience. Brands can configure buttons such as Buy Now, Dealer Locator, and Distributor Locator, or combine multiple entry points into a single customer journey. After clicking, consumers can view online store links and maps of nearby locations. Results may include ratings, opening hours, phone numbers, addresses, and support for route navigation, click-to-call, and sharing.
The platform also tracks customer actions and provides analytics by product, seller, and geography. This helps brands understand which products are attracting interest, which partners customers are connecting with, and where interactions are happening across cities, regions, or countries. Sellers can also receive reports on visits, phone calls, route requests, shares, and other interactions generated by suppliers.
The official website content does not disclose plans, pricing, billing units, a free tier, or trial information, and only provides a Request a Demo option. This makes it look more like a sales-led SaaS product where pricing is provided after booking a demo. Deployment is described only as an online platform, with no clear indication of whether private deployment or self-hosting is supported. Key enterprise software capabilities such as third-party integrations, API access, SSO, and permission management are also not mentioned in the main site content, so these should be重点 questions before procurement.
The main advantage is its focused use case: Omacro is not a general-purpose CRM, but a tool specifically designed to solve the channel conversion problem of “where can customers buy this / who should they contact for service.” It covers both online and offline paths and feeds customer behavior data back to both brands and sellers.
The downside is the lack of public information, especially around pricing, data security and compliance, developer capabilities, and team permissions. This makes it difficult to directly assess total cost of ownership and integration complexity.
Omacro is suitable for brands with multi-region dealer, distributor, service center, or installation networks, especially companies that want to improve conversion on official product pages and measure channel contribution. Access performance from mainland China is unknown, and payment methods are not disclosed.
If targeting the Chinese market, you should confirm map service support, local phone number handling, address quality, cross-border access speed, and compliance requirements. An alternative approach would be to combine local map capabilities with a self-built dealer lookup page.
